EAช่างผู้เชี่ยวชาญคอร์ส EA【015】มักมองข้าม? การทดสอบย้อนหลังของการซื้อขายอัตโนมัติและการทดสอบฟอร์เวิร์ด ควรให้ความสำคัญกับอันไหนมากกว่ากัน?
เอา EA นี้ไปใช้งานได้ตลอดหรือไม่ที่จะชนะต่อไป?
หากคุณเคยมีประสบการณ์ที่ตื่นเต้นกับผลการทดสอบย้อนหลังแล้วไปใช้งานจริงโดยลมฟ้าอากาศหือๆ แล้วล้มเหลวม็คงไม่ต้องบอกก็รู้ว่า ผู้ที่สงสัยหรือลักษณะระมัดระวังจะ...「แน่นอนมันต้องทดสอบแบบ Forward Test ดสิ แม้แสดงกำไรจากข้อมูลในอดีตก็ตาม แต่มันยังไม่สามารถเชื่อถือได้มากพอ ต้องเห็นทำกำไรจริงในการเทรดจริงด้วยถึงจะเชื่อ」
ผมคิดว่าเป็นการตอบเช่นนี้
แล้วคำถามคือ หากตอนนี้ EA ที่ทุกคนใช้งานอยู่สามารถทำกำไรได้ต่อเนื่องอย่างราบรื่น ความน่าจะเป็นที่มันจะทำกำไรแบบเดิมต่อไปในอนาคตมีมากน้อยแค่ไหนที่คุณคิด?
และฐานข้อมูลหรือหลักฐานที่คุณใช้คืออะไร?
เป็นไปได้ไหมว่าแค่โชคดีหรือลมพัดตามขึ้นลง?
งานของผู้ดูแล EA
เมื่อดูแลใช้งาน EA ผู้ดูแลที่ตรวจค้นและวิเคราะห์ด้วยตนเองจะดูผลลัพธ์จากทั้งการทดสอบย้อนหลังและการทดสอบ Forward อย่างเปรียบเทียบกัน แล้วตัดสินใจว่าจะดำเนินการต่อไปอย่างไร ปรับขนาดโพสิชัน หรือหยุดชั่วคราว หยุดทั้งหมด หรือทำการหยุดชั่วคราวไว้ก่อนความหมายของการมุ่งมั่นในวิธีชนะ
แน่นอนถ้าไม่ชนะใน Real Trade หรือ Forward Test ก็เป็นเรื่องที่ทำให้เรื่องนี้มีความหมายไม่ได้ นั่นคือความจริงแต่การชนะเพียงอย่างเดียวไม่ได้หมายถึงทุกอย่างเสมอไป
「เอ๊ะ? จุดประสงค์ของการเทรดคือการทำเงิน ดังนั้นไม่ว่าวิธีชนะแบบไหนก็ชนะก็นับว่าเป็นฝ่ายถูกใช่ไหม?」
ท่านพูดถูก หาก EA นี้จะทำกำไรต่อไปในอนาคตตลอดไปก็อาจจะพอใจได้
แต่เราจะรู้ได้อย่างไร? บางทีทำไมถึงมีออเดอร์ที่ทำกำไรอยู่แต่ไม่ทราบสาเหตุ บรรยากาศแบบนี้ไม่ทำให้กลัวเหรอ เมื่อเกิด Drawdown ขึ้นล่ะ?
「เอ๊ะ... EA นี้ควรหยุดใช้งานดีไหมนะ?」
หรือไม่?
Backtest คือผู้ช่วยที่แข็งแกร่ง
ผู้ช่วยที่แข็งแกร่งในตอนนั้นก็คือผลลัพธ์ของ backtestดูว่า “วิธีชนะ” ใน Forward Test หรือการใช้งานจริงสอดคล้องกับ backtest มากน้อยแค่ไหน นี่คือสิ่งที่ควรดู
นั่นคือ ความสามารถในการทำซ้ำได้
หากทำกำไรตามสภาพ backtest ได้ นั่นหมายถึงตรรกะมีความสามารถในการทำซ้ำสูง หากทำกำไรโดยวิธีที่แตกต่างกันมาก นั่นหมายถึงมีกำไรแต่ความสามารถในการทำซ้ำต่ำ
ตราบใดที่มีความสามารถในการทำซ้ำต่ำแต่ยังสร้างกำไรอยู่... กล่าวคือ ไม่ได้อาศัยความได้เปรียบที่คาดการณ์ไว้... และยิ่งกว่านั้น ไม่รู้สาเหตุว่าทำไมจึงทำกำไร...
คนเรียกว่าเหตุการณ์นี้ว่าเป็นการ “บังเอิญ”
อย่างที่บอกในคอร์สที่ 10 การทดสอบย้อนหลังไม่ควรสั้นเกินไป แต่ไม่ใช่ว่าจะยาวเกินไปก็ไม่ได้ด้วย บทความนั้นมีรายละเอียดเพิ่มเติมอยู่
สรุปอย่างเดียวก็คือ อย่างน้อยต้องมีระยะเวลา 3 ปี และถ้าเป็นไปได้ควรใน 5 ปีขึ้นไป
อย่างไรก็ตาม ตัวอย่างเช่น 20 ปีหรือมากกว่านั้นถือว่าอาจจะน่าสงสัย โปรดดูเหตุผลในคอร์สที่ 10
■ แนวคิดและนโยบายการใช้งาน EA ที่ผมพัฒนาขึ้น
EA ช่างฝีมือ (EA 3箭) คลิกที่นี่× ![]()